Back to Therabody. In 2020, it was rebranding and had been awarded space inside Walmart. Great product. Great opportunity. So... what’s next?

Miller Zell had created an end cap style guide and signage template for CPGs entering Walmart. Therabody partnered with Miller Zell and our Retail Marketing Solutions (RMS) team to design displays and shelving for the Theragun deep muscle treatment and other wellness products inside the world’s largest retailer. Impressed with the designs and our end-to-end services, Therabody asked Miller Zell to create end caps and shelving for other retailers, such as Target, Walgreens, Bed Bath & Beyond and Best Buy.

Increased retail distribution, sales growth

Therabody increased its retailer distribution from 40 stores in the U.S. to more than 17,000 retailers globally. Helping to manage this rapid growth, Miller Zell provides Therabody logistics and inventory management, while our design development and procurement teams continue to value-engineer displays to save them money. We also developed a customized website that uses our proprietary technology, REACH™, so sales reps can order from a full catalogue of fixtures, displays, graphics, etc., for any retail location.

Consumers have more choices than ever before, and they seek brands that stand out and put them at the center of the product experience. Research from McKinsey found that “71 percent of consumers expect companies to deliver personalized interactions. And 76 percent get frustrated when this doesn’t happen.”

But while almost all marketing professionals say they’re investing in personalizing the customer experience, only a small percentage of consumers believe their experience is effectively customized for their wants and needs.

The in-store experience with your product should seamlessly blend with online and social engagement. This starts with product information — research online, buy offline — but continues with social content that attracts younger customers who are creating User Generated Content (UGC) among family and friends or even to a larger influencer audience.

Many shoppers use their smartphones in-store to look at price comparisons, read product reviews, seek advice from friends/family and/or watch product demonstrations.
